Commode installation services involve replacing or upgrading a toilet fixture within a bathroom. This process typically includes removing the existing commode, preparing the installation area, and securely fitting a new toilet to ensure proper function and stability. Professional service providers handle all aspects of the installation to ensure the fixture is correctly positioned, sealed, and connected to plumbing systems, helping to create a clean and functional bathroom environment.

These services are often sought to address issues such as frequent clogs, leaks, or outdated fixtures that no longer meet the needs of the household. Installing a new commode can improve bathroom hygiene, reduce water waste, and enhance overall convenience. Whether upgrading to a more efficient model or replacing a damaged unit, experienced contractors can help homeowners resolve common toilet-related problems effectively.

The overview below groups typical Commode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or commode repairs, such as replacing a flapper or fixing a leak, often range from $100 to $300. Many routine repairs fall within this lower to mid-range, depending on parts and labor involved.

Full Replacement - Replacing an existing commode with a new unit usually costs between $250 and $600. Most standard installations are in this range, with fewer projects reaching higher prices due to additional features or complexities.

Custom Installations - Custom or upgraded commode installations, including specialty models or advanced features, can range from $600 to $1,200. These higher-end projects are less common but may be necessary for specific preferences or requirements.

Complex or Large-Scale Projects - Larger or more complex commode installation projects, such as those involving plumbing modifications, can cost $1,200 or more. Such projects are less frequent and typically involve extensive work or unusual site conditions.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is involved in commode installation? Commode installation typically includes removing the old toilet, preparing the flange and flooring, and securely installing the new commode to ensure proper function and fit.

Can a service provider handle different types of commodes? Yes, local contractors are experienced with various types of toilets, including standard, comfort height, and dual-flush models.

Is it necessary to have plumbing experience to install a commode? While some installations are straightforward, many homeowners prefer to contact professionals who have the necessary expertise to ensure proper setup and avoid issues.

What should be prepared before a commode installation appointment? It’s helpful to have the old toilet removed and the area cleared, and to select the new commode model to be installed.

Are there different installation options for commodes? Yes, service providers can install various models, including wall-mounted or standard floor-mounted toilets, depending on the bathroom setup and preferences.
